Quality: Select small to medium-size mature potatoes of ideal quality for cooking. Tubers stored below 45ºF may discolor when canned. Choose potatoes 1 to 2 inches in diameter if they are to be packed whole.Quantity: An average of 21 pounds (without tops) is needed per canner load of 7 quarts; an average of 13-1/2 pounds is needed per canner load of 9 pints. A bushel (without tops) weighs 52 pounds and yields 15 to 20 quarts--an average of 3 pounds per quart. Quality: Beets with a diameter of 1 to 2 inches are preferred for whole packs. A pint is: about half a liter. more precisely 473.176473 milliliters. A quart is: about a liter. more precisely 946.352946 milliliters. A gallon is:A peck of apples is roughly two gallons of apples. Or two small bags of apples. A peck of apples weighs around 10-12 pounds, which is also 1/4 of a bushel. However, ultimately, a peck is equal to 8 dry quarts or 537.6 cubic inches. The " how many cubic feet is 8 quarts of soil " is a question that has been asked for years.Thus, the volume in pounds is equal to the quarts multiplied by 2.086351 times the density of the ingredient or material. For example, here's how to convert 5 quarts to pounds for an ingredient with a density of 0.7 g/mL. 5 qt = 5 × 2.086351 × 0.7 = 7.302229 lb. The density of water at 4°C is about 8.34 lb/gal , i.e., 1 gallon of water weights 8.34 pounds . A quart is equal to a quarter of a gallon, hence, 1 quart of water is about 8.34 / 4 = 2.085 lb .FSo a bushel is 32 dry quarts, and a peck is 8 dry quarts.
